ABSTRACT:
A collapsible sheath secured in seal-tight manner on an arm of a Y-site connector to define a closed chamber for a guide wire. The guide wire is mounted at one end in a seal ring located in a bore of the arm of the connector and can be slid through the ring to be implanted in a body cavity, such as a blood vessel.
